Quotes of Maltbie D. Babcock

somelinesforyou_161889355872.jpg

Be on the lookout for mercies. The more we look for them, the more of them we will see… Better to loose count while naming your blessings than to lose your blessings to counting your troubles.

- Maltbie D. Babcock
